The Quality Assurance Agency for Higher Education (QAA) has confirmed the quality and standards of provision at Petroc following its review in November 2014.
Would you like to attend The Prince’s Trust Explore Enterprise Course, running in Barnstaple on 24th – 27th February at Barnstaple Fire station. The Prince’s Trust Explore Enterprise course is a four day exploration of the skills and requirements a person will need to become self employed.
